Unleash the People Potential in your Business

 Enable your high performers to partner with you, drive business growth, and engage in a culture of development. Investing in their future means you keep the right people and create the type of culture that other top performers want to be part of.

Join us at this short sharp HR breakfast where our experts will challenge you on how to genuinely invest in your staff through developing and leveraging skills already existing in your business. Our presenters will discuss:

  • Strengthening the leadership bench – building critical skills and competencies for your pipeline of future leaders and mitigating the ‘readiness gap’
  • Recruiting and aligning people with your company mission – how to win the war on talent, every day of the year
  • Making dreams reality – people, purpose & pay – where do you want to be and how are you going to get there?

Cathy Hendry from Strategic Pay will discuss how to plan long term reward and recognition programs to ensure you are aligning pay and purpose with growth and development. They will also cover how to reward good behaviour and attitudes that contribute towards fostering a great workplace culture.
